Ahead of the summer transfer window, Carlos Ancelotti has reportedly set his sights on bringing an impressive Everton star to Real Madrid in what would deal David Moyes a frustrating blow.

Everton transfer news

Moyes has so far picked up where he left off at Everton over a decade ago, even giving Goodison Park a final Merseyside derby to remember courtesy of James Tarkowski’s stunning last-minute equaliser. It’s the type of moment that he will hope to witness at the new Bramley-Moore Dock stadium which recently hosted its first test event – an academy fixture between Everton and Wigan Athletic.

Meanwhile, back at Goodison Park the senior side are preparing to welcome a struggling Manchester United side in the hope of making it five games without defeat in the Premier League.

Victory would also see the Toffees move four points clear of the Red Devils – representing just how much Moyes’ arrival has turned things around for those in Merseyside. That success is not going unnoticed, however, and one particular player is now reportedly attracting quite the attention.

According to The Mirror, Ancelotti now personally wants Real Madrid to sign Jarrad Branthwaite, who could be allowed to leave Everton for the right price this summer despite watching on as Manchester United’s bids were rejected in pursuit of his signature last year.

Worth £75m in the eyes of the Merseyside club last season, it remains to be seen if that valuation will stick one year on. After a difficult start to the campaign, Branthwaite has burst back into life under Moyes and back into the headlines on the transfer front.

Still just 22 years old, the central defender could yet reunite with the man who handed him his Everton debut if Real Madrid come calling this summer.

“Excellent” Branthwaite could have decision to make

Just like last summer, Branthwaite could have the ultimate decision to make when the transfer window swings open. Except this time, it’s Real Madrid knocking and not a fragile Manchester United side. Whether the defender swings the door open this time around remains to be seen, but the La Liga giants are rarely turned down.
